I have 6 cards from the 1934 Gold Medal Foods world series issue. Along with these are an Al Simmons, Ossie Oswald, George Earnslaw, Roy Hudson and Chuck Klein that look like they could be from the same set but aren't included in anything I can find. I would appreciate any information anyone could give me on these. I have done quite a bit of research on line and this forum is the best I have found. Thanks for any help. glbills

There was an article about these cards in the most recent Old Cardboard magazine (www.oldcardboard.com is the website -- I'm sure you can still order the issue). There were apparently two sets issued, one commemorating the 1934 World Series, and one issued of players that were not in the World Series. The non-World-Series cards are not yet cataloged, but I suspect the will be in next year's Standard Catalog of Baseball Cards.
